Hari ini ada sedikit perasaan malas, mungkinn dikarenakan pengaruh hari libur nasional. Dalam kesempatan sekarang marilah mencoba bverkreasi dengan latihan mikrokontroller Arduino dan sensor suhu lm 35. nah untuk memudahkan pembacaan hasilnya kita tambahkan lcd 16x2 karakter
Coba perhatikan gambar diatas. perhatikan keterangan kaki lm 35 dengan seksama, rekan rekan harus memahami mana kaki data yang akan mengantarkan nilai suhu dan mana kaki yang harus dihubungkan ke mikrokontroller arduino
Kaki Output dari lm 35 kita hubungkan ke kaki Arduino A0
tegangan 5 Volt kita sambungkan dengan tegangan yang disediakan mikrokontroller
Ground nya juga kita hibungkan dengan groun mikrokontroller
Untuk menghubungkan mikrokontroller dengan lcd 16x2 karakter lihatlah gambar dibawah ini saja yaaa
Nah list programnya adalah seperti di bawah ini. skedar saran kepada rekan rekan yang serius belajar mikrokontroller. cobalah list ini diketik kembali dan jangan hanya copy paste untuk melatih mengetik sekaligus akan lebih memahami program secara terperinci
******************************************************************
//declare variables
float tempC;
int tempPin = 0;
#include <LiquidCrystal.h>
LiquidCrystal lcd(12, 11, 5, 4, 3, 2);
void setup()
{
lcd.begin(16, 2);
Serial.begin(9600); //opens serial port, sets data rate to 9600 bps
}
void loop()
{
lcd.clear();
tempC = analogRead(tempPin); //read the value from the sensor
tempC = (5.0 * tempC * 100.0)/1024.0; //convert the analog data to temperature
Serial.println((byte)tempC); //send the data to the computer
lcd.setCursor(0, 0);
lcd.print(String(tempC));
delay(1000); //wait one second before sending new data
}
******************************************************************
bila program yang ada di atas sudah selesai di ketik ulang, cobalah di compail dan di upload ke alat. nah perhatikan hasil pengukuran nya adal di lcd. selain di lcd hasil pengukuran juga dapat dilihat di serial monitor yang terdapat di IDE Arduino.
Gambar di atas adalah hasil pengukuran melalui layar serial montor. Tolong jangan tanya betul apa tidak atau hanya sekedar kebetulan. tetapi setidaknya programnya sukses dan dapat diupload ke mikrokontroller dan hasil suhunya ada. Sisanya silahkan rekan rekan kembangkan lebih lanjut
Nah sekarang marilah kita kembangkan lagi agar alat yang dibuat ini hasil pengukuranya terdapat di layar hape Android. Yang di butuhkan adalah
1. hape Android Murah Meriah yang penting ada konektivitas Bluetooth.
2. Hape Samsung dengan Harga minimal 4 Juta ke atas.
3. Aplikasi Online Mit App Inventor
Hape Android Biasa atau Hp Android yang Saudara miliki akan kita gunakanb untuk dipasang program atau aplikasi yang akan kita buat melalui situs App Inventor 2. Sedangkan HP Samsung yang mahal silahkan kirim ke Kang Mas Yadi Yaaaaa..... Huahahahhahahahaahaaaaaa
Nah sekarang perhatikan Gambar di bawah ini yaaaaaaa......
Yang Kita perlukan dalam pembuatan aplikasi ini adalah
List Picker untuk Menyambungkan perangkat dengan mikrokontroller Arduino melalui perangkat bluetooth
Label
Text box untuk menampilkan hasil pengukuran suhu
Setelah Program yang kita rancang di Aplikasi online Mit App Inventor selesai di buat maka downloadlah dan pasang di Hape Android yaaa.. coba jalankan. tampilannya adalah seperti gambar dibawah ini
Mohon Maap yaaa.. Banyak sekaliiiii kekurangannya... Harap maklum bangetttttt.....
Tidak ada komentar:
Posting Komentar